Norwegian is launching four new routes from London Gatwick to Grenoble, Salzburg, Madeira and La Palma this winter.
The carrier will also increase the number of weekly flights from LGW to Rome, Larnaca and Lanzarote.
From December 13, Norwegian will operate one weekly flight from Gatwick to both Grenoble and Salzburg. Both services operate on Saturdays.
Starting October 28, the airline will operate a twice-weekly service to Madeira, on Tuesdays and Saturdays, and from November 1, it will fly once weekly to La Palma on Saturdays.
Earlier this month, Norwegian vowed to put an end to "unreasonably high" transatlantic air fares as it celebrated the launch of its first flights between London Gatwick and the US (see news, July 4).
The carrier flies twice weekly from Gatwick to Los Angeles and Fort Lauderdale and thrice weekly to New York.
